Definition and explanation

A purchase and sale agreement is a written contract between the buyer and seller that outlines the property, price, financing, and conditions to closing.

Key elements and processes

Key elements include property description, purchase price, contingencies, disclosures, inspections, and closing logistics.

Key terms and glossary

Glossary of terms used in purchase and sale agreements helps clarify responsibilities and rights.

Purchase Price

The price agreed for the property that the buyer will pay to the seller.

Contingencies

Conditions that must be satisfied before closing, such as financing approval or inspection results.

Closing Date

The date on which ownership transfers to the buyer, typically at closing.

Earnest Money

A deposit showing the buyer’s serious intent to proceed with the purchase.

What is a purchase and sale agreement?

It is a written contract between the buyer and seller that outlines the property, price, contingencies, and closing date. A well drafted agreement helps prevent disputes, clarifies responsibilities, and smooths the path to a clear title transfer.
